数据仓库有哪些特征
-
数据仓库的特征主要包括集成性、主题性、非易失性、时间变性、支持决策。数据仓库以集成性为基础,意味着它将来自不同来源的数据进行整合,形成一个统一的视图,便于分析和决策。集成性不仅是数据仓库设计的核心理念,还涉及到数据清洗、转换和加载(ETL)过程,使得来自不同系统的数据可以无缝结合,提供一致性的信息。这种集成使得企业能够消除数据孤岛,从而更好地利用信息资源,推动业务发展。随着企业信息化程度的提高,集成性在数据仓库的构建和应用中显得尤为重要。
一、集成性
数据仓库的集成性体现在它能够将来自不同数据源的信息整合到一起。这些数据源可以包括事务处理系统、外部数据源、社交媒体等。通过对这些数据的整合,数据仓库能够提供一个全面的视角,使得决策者能够更好地理解业务运营和市场动态。在集成过程中,数据清洗和转换是至关重要的环节。数据清洗能够消除数据中的错误和冗余,确保数据的准确性和一致性;而数据转换则将不同格式的数据转化为统一的结构,方便后续分析。
集成性的实现需要借助强大的ETL工具,这些工具能够自动化地从不同来源提取数据,进行必要的清洗和转换,最终加载到数据仓库中。此外,随着大数据技术的发展,数据仓库的集成性也在不断提升,能够处理更大规模和更复杂的数据集。数据集成不仅提高了数据的可用性,也增强了分析的深度,为企业提供了更具价值的洞察。
二、主题性
数据仓库的主题性表明,它的设计是围绕特定的业务主题或领域而构建的。这意味着数据仓库中的数据是根据业务需求进行组织的,而不是按照操作系统的结构。主题性使得用户可以更容易地获取与特定业务相关的信息,从而支持决策过程。例如,一个零售企业的数据仓库可能围绕销售、库存、客户等多个主题进行设计。
每个主题下的数据不仅包含历史记录,还能够支持趋势分析和预测。通过对主题数据的深入分析,企业能够识别出潜在的市场机会和风险。因此,主题性的设计不仅提高了数据的可用性,也增强了分析的针对性,帮助企业在复杂的业务环境中做出更有效的决策。
三、非易失性
非易失性是数据仓库的一个重要特征,指的是数据在数据仓库中是持久存在的,不会因日常的操作而被修改或删除。数据仓库中的数据通常是历史数据,经过ETL过程后被加载到仓库中,形成稳定的备份。这种特性保证了企业能够随时访问到历史数据,进行长期趋势分析和业务绩效评估。
非易失性还意味着数据仓库中的数据能够提供一致的视图,避免了在不同时间点对同一数据的不同解读。这对于企业进行决策和评估至关重要,因为决策者需要依据准确且一致的数据来制定策略。此外,非易失性也为数据治理和合规性提供了保障,企业可以更好地遵循行业法规,确保数据的安全和可靠。
四、时间变性
时间变性是指数据仓库中的数据是随时间变化而更新的。与传统的操作系统不同,数据仓库会保留历史数据,使得用户能够进行时间序列分析。这种特性使得企业可以追踪业务绩效的变化、市场趋势的演变,以及客户行为的转变。时间变性为决策者提供了深度的洞察,帮助他们理解过去的业务决策及其影响。
在数据仓库中,时间变性通常通过维度建模实现,数据仓库会对时间进行分层管理,通常以日、月、季、年为单位进行分析。通过这种方式,企业能够轻松生成各种时间维度的报告,快速识别出关键的时间节点和趋势变化。这种功能在业务规划、市场营销和财务分析等领域都发挥着重要作用,帮助企业制定更有效的策略。
五、支持决策
数据仓库的最终目的是支持决策。通过提供准确、及时和相关的数据,数据仓库能够帮助企业管理层做出明智的决策。在快速变化的市场环境中,企业需要依赖数据来评估业务绩效、识别市场机会和风险,以及制定战略规划。数据仓库能够提供全面的分析工具,帮助企业从海量数据中提取有价值的信息,为决策提供数据支持。
此外,数据仓库通过集成分析工具和商业智能(BI)平台,使得用户能够更方便地访问和分析数据。用户可以通过自助服务的方式进行数据查询和报表生成,而不需要依赖IT部门的支持。这种灵活性和自主性不仅提高了决策效率,也增强了企业的竞争力,使得企业能够快速响应市场变化,抓住机遇。
1年前 -
数据仓库的特征包括集成性、主题性、不可变性、时间变性、非易失性。其中,集成性是数据仓库的关键特征,它指的是数据仓库能够将来自不同来源的数据进行整合,形成统一的数据视图。这种集成不仅限于数据的物理存储,还涉及到数据的格式、语义和内容的标准化,以便于用户进行分析和查询。通过集成,数据仓库能够提供更全面的信息,支持企业在决策过程中获得更深入的洞察,提升数据分析的效率和准确性。
一、集成性
数据仓库的集成性意味着它能够从多个数据源中提取、清洗和整合数据。数据源可能包括关系数据库、文件系统、在线交易处理系统(OLTP)等。通过ETL(提取、转换、加载)过程,数据仓库能够把这些异构的数据转化为一致的格式,确保数据的准确性和一致性。这一过程通常涉及数据清洗、去重、标准化等步骤,从而消除冗余和不一致性,让用户能够在同一个平台上进行全面分析。此外,集成性还体现在数据的语义层面,通过定义统一的数据模型,使得不同来源的数据能够在逻辑上相互关联,支持更复杂的分析需求。
二、主题性
数据仓库的主题性特征意味着数据是围绕特定主题进行组织的,而不是按业务流程或应用程序组织。主题可能包括客户、产品、销售、财务等。这样的组织方式使得数据仓库更容易满足分析需求,因为分析人员可以更方便地获取与特定主题相关的数据。通过主题性,数据仓库能够提供更清晰的数据视图,支持业务决策的灵活性与深度。例如,在一个零售企业的数据仓库中,客户主题可能包含客户的购买历史、偏好、反馈等信息,而产品主题则包含产品的库存、定价、促销等信息。通过跨主题的数据分析,企业能够识别出客户的购买趋势、产品的市场表现等关键信息。
三、不可变性
数据仓库的不可变性指的是一旦数据被加载到仓库中,通常不会被修改或删除。这一特征确保了历史数据的完整性,使得企业能够追踪数据的变化和演变过程。不可变性对于企业进行长期趋势分析和历史数据对比至关重要。例如,在金融行业,企业需要保持过去几年的交易记录,以便进行合规审计和风险管理。不可变性还支持时效性分析,通过对比不同时间点的数据,企业能够识别出市场的变化、客户行为的演变等,从而做出更加精准的业务决策。
四、时间变性
数据仓库的时间变性特征指的是数据仓库能够存储历史数据,并且支持对时间维度的分析。这意味着数据不仅反映了当前的状态,还能够追溯历史数据的变化。时间变性通常通过时间戳、版本控制等方式实现,使得用户可以分析不同时间段的数据趋势。这一特征在业务决策中非常重要,企业能够通过时间维度来识别季节性变化、市场趋势等。例如,零售企业可以分析过去几年的销售数据,识别出哪些产品在特定季节的销售表现更好,从而优化库存管理和营销策略。
五、非易失性
数据仓库的非易失性特征意味着一旦数据被存储在数据仓库中,它将被永久保存,直到明确需要删除或归档。这一特征确保了数据的持久性,使得企业能够随时访问历史数据进行分析。非易失性为数据仓库提供了稳定的查询性能,用户可以根据需要随时获取所需数据进行分析,而不必担心数据的丢失或变更。通过非易失性,企业能够建立完整的历史数据集,为未来的决策提供可靠的依据。比如,企业可以利用历史数据来评估营销活动的效果,分析客户的购买行为变化,从而制定更有效的市场策略。
六、数据质量
数据仓库的数据质量特征是指数据在数据仓库中应具备的准确性、完整性和一致性。良好的数据质量是进行有效分析的基础,企业必须确保加载到数据仓库中的数据是经过清洗和验证的。数据质量管理通常包括数据验证、数据清洗和数据监控等过程,以确保数据在生命周期中的各个阶段都保持高质量。例如,在金融行业,数据质量的好坏直接影响到风险评估和决策的准确性。因此,企业需要建立严格的数据质量标准和监控机制,以确保数据仓库中的数据始终符合业务需求。
七、易扩展性
数据仓库的易扩展性特征意味着随着业务的发展和数据量的增加,数据仓库能够灵活地进行扩展。这种扩展不仅包括存储能力的增加,还包括系统性能的提升、数据处理能力的增强等。现代数据仓库通常采用分布式架构和云计算技术,能够轻松应对海量数据的存储和处理需求。企业可以根据业务需求的变化,快速扩展数据仓库的容量和计算能力,而无需进行复杂的系统升级。这一特征使得企业能够灵活应对市场变化,保持竞争优势。
八、用户友好性
数据仓库的用户友好性特征指的是系统能够为用户提供简单易用的界面和工具,使得用户能够方便地进行数据查询和分析。现代数据仓库通常集成了可视化工具、报表工具和自助分析工具,使得非技术用户也能够轻松访问和分析数据。用户友好性不仅提高了数据分析的效率,还降低了用户的学习成本,促进了数据驱动决策的普及。企业可以通过培训和支持,使得更多的员工能够利用数据仓库进行业务分析,从而提升整体的决策能力。
九、支持多种数据类型
数据仓库的支持多种数据类型特征意味着它能够处理结构化数据、半结构化数据和非结构化数据。随着大数据技术的发展,企业需要处理的数据类型日益多样化,传统的数据仓库往往只能处理结构化数据,而现代数据仓库则能够支持多种数据类型的存储和分析。这一特征使得企业能够整合来自不同渠道的数据,例如社交媒体数据、日志文件、传感器数据等,从而获得更全面的业务洞察。通过对多种数据类型的支持,企业能够更好地理解客户需求、市场趋势和运营效率,从而做出更为精准的决策。
十、实时数据处理能力
数据仓库的实时数据处理能力特征指的是系统能够及时处理和更新数据,使得用户能够获得最新的信息。这一特征在快速变化的商业环境中尤为重要,企业需要能够实时监控和分析数据,以便快速做出反应。通过采用流处理技术和实时数据集成工具,数据仓库能够支持实时数据的加载和分析,使得企业能够获得最新的市场动态和客户反馈。这一能力不仅提升了决策的及时性,也增强了企业的敏捷性,帮助企业在竞争中保持领先地位。
数据仓库的特征构成了其在企业数据管理和分析中的核心价值,通过理解这些特征,企业可以更好地利用数据仓库来支持业务决策,提升运营效率,增强市场竞争力。
1年前 -
数据仓库的主要特征包括:集中管理、数据集成、历史数据存储、数据分析优化。数据仓库作为一种专门设计用于支持决策的数据管理系统,它通过集中管理和整合来自不同来源的数据,确保信息的一致性和完整性。数据仓库不仅可以保存大量历史数据,还可以对这些数据进行复杂的查询和分析,以支持业务决策。数据仓库的设计使得它特别适合进行数据挖掘、趋势分析和报表生成。
一、集中管理
集中管理是数据仓库的核心特征之一,指的是所有数据都汇集在一个统一的系统中。这种集中管理的优势在于可以避免数据孤岛问题,即不同部门或系统之间的数据隔离。通过集中管理,企业能够更好地维护数据的一致性和完整性,从而提升数据的可靠性和准确性。为了实现集中管理,数据仓库通常会采用数据抽取、转换和加载(ETL)工具,将来自不同来源的数据整合到一个统一的平台上。这些工具不仅帮助将数据从各种异构源中提取出来,还进行数据的清洗和转换,以确保数据在数据仓库中的一致性。
二、数据集成
数据集成是指将来自不同来源的数据整合到数据仓库中的过程。这一过程包括数据抽取、转换和加载(ETL)。数据集成的关键在于能够将来自不同系统、不同格式的数据进行统一的处理,从而实现数据的一致性。数据集成通常需要解决数据格式不一致、数据质量问题等挑战。为了有效地集成数据,数据仓库通常会使用数据集成工具,这些工具能够支持各种数据源和数据格式,并通过数据转换规则将数据标准化。这一过程不仅提升了数据的质量,还使得企业可以通过统一的数据视图来进行分析和决策。
三、历史数据存储
历史数据存储是数据仓库的一项重要功能,它允许用户存储和访问过去的数据。与传统的在线事务处理(OLTP)系统不同,数据仓库专注于处理历史数据和趋势分析。历史数据存储的好处在于它支持长期的数据分析和比较,使得企业能够观察到数据随时间的变化情况,从而做出更有依据的决策。为了实现历史数据的有效存储,数据仓库通常采用分区技术和归档策略。这些技术可以帮助管理数据的存储和访问,确保数据的长期保留和高效检索。
四、数据分析优化
数据分析优化是数据仓库的关键特征之一,它确保了数据查询和分析的高效性。数据仓库的设计专门针对复杂的查询和数据分析进行了优化,包括多维数据模型和高效的查询处理。为了实现数据分析优化,数据仓库通常采用数据立方体、物化视图和索引等技术。这些技术可以加速数据的检索过程,并支持多维度的数据分析,使得用户能够快速获得有价值的业务洞察。通过这些优化技术,数据仓库能够处理大量数据并支持复杂的分析需求,帮助企业从海量数据中提取出关键的信息。
五、数据质量管理
数据质量管理是确保数据仓库中数据准确性和可靠性的重要措施。数据质量管理包括数据清洗、数据验证和数据标准化等过程。数据清洗用于识别和修正数据中的错误或不一致,数据验证则确保数据符合预定的规则和标准,而数据标准化则使数据格式统一。通过这些措施,数据仓库能够提供高质量的数据,支持准确的分析和决策。数据质量管理不仅仅是技术问题,还涉及到数据治理和数据管理的策略,确保整个数据生命周期中数据质量的持续改善。
六、用户访问管理
用户访问管理是数据仓库的一项重要功能,确保数据的安全性和隐私保护。用户访问管理涉及到权限控制、身份验证和审计等方面。通过权限控制,数据仓库可以定义不同用户的访问权限,确保用户只能访问其授权的数据。身份验证则确保只有合法用户能够登录系统,而审计则记录用户的操作行为,以便进行安全监控和问题追踪。有效的用户访问管理能够防止未经授权的数据访问和潜在的数据泄露风险,保障数据仓库的安全性。
七、数据建模
数据建模是数据仓库设计的基础,涉及到数据的组织和结构化。数据建模通常采用星型模型或雪花模型等多维数据模型,以便支持复杂的查询和分析需求。星型模型通过事实表和维度表的组织,简化了查询过程,而雪花模型则通过更复杂的维度结构,提供了更高的灵活性和数据细节。数据建模不仅决定了数据的存储结构,还影响到数据的查询性能和分析效率。精心设计的数据模型能够提高数据仓库的性能,支持高效的数据访问和分析。
八、数据安全
数据安全是数据仓库设计和管理中不可忽视的一部分,涉及到数据保护、防止数据丢失和确保数据隐私。数据安全措施包括数据加密、备份和恢复机制,以及安全审计。数据加密可以保护数据在传输和存储过程中的安全,而备份和恢复机制则确保数据在出现故障或丢失时能够及时恢复。安全审计则记录和监控数据访问行为,以便发现潜在的安全威胁。通过这些安全措施,数据仓库能够确保数据的完整性、保密性和可用性,防止数据丢失和安全漏洞。
九、数据可扩展性
数据可扩展性是数据仓库能够适应不断增长的数据量和用户需求的能力。数据可扩展性包括水平扩展和垂直扩展。水平扩展通过增加更多的服务器或节点来分散负载,而垂直扩展则通过升级现有服务器的硬件配置来提高性能。为了实现数据的可扩展性,数据仓库通常采用分布式架构和分区技术。这些技术能够帮助处理大量的数据,并支持高并发的用户访问,确保系统在高负载情况下的稳定性和性能。
十、数据整合和一致性
数据整合和一致性是确保数据仓库中数据的完整性和统一性的关键特征。数据整合涉及将来自不同数据源的数据进行统一处理,以消除数据之间的不一致。数据一致性则确保数据在整个数据仓库中保持一致,无论是通过数据验证规则,还是通过数据同步机制。数据整合和一致性的管理能够提升数据的可靠性和准确性,帮助用户进行更加准确的数据分析和决策。通过数据整合和一致性措施,数据仓库能够提供一个稳定的数据平台,支持企业的各种分析和决策需求。
1年前


